办公小浣熊
Raccoon - AI 智能助手

如何实现AI知识库的自动更新与维护?

如何实现AI知识库的自动更新与维护?

在人工智能技术快速迭代的当下,AI知识库已成为企业智能化转型的核心基础设施。然而,一个普遍存在的痛点是:耗费大量资源构建的知识库,在上线后很快便出现信息陈旧、更新滞后的问题。如何实现知识库的自动更新与维护,已成为技术团队亟待解决的关键课题。本文将围绕这一主题,展开系统性的调查与分析。

一、AI知识库自动更新的核心现实背景

AI知识库的自动更新,并非简单的技术问题,而是涉及数据来源、质量控制、流程设计等多个环节的系统性工程。当前行业普遍面临的核心困境在于:知识库的初始建设往往投入巨大,但后续维护成本高昂,且人工更新效率低下,难以跟上信息变化的节奏。

以小浣熊AI智能助手的实践为例,其知识库管理模块采用了多层次的自动更新机制。首先是数据源的对接,需要建立与外部信息系统的实时或准实时同步通道;其次是内容的智能筛选与过滤,确保更新内容的质量;最后是版本管理与回滚机制,保障系统的稳定性。这三个环节缺一不可,构成了自动更新的基础架构。

从行业整体来看,AI知识库的维护主要面临三方面压力。一是业务知识的快速迭代,新产品、新政策、新流程不断涌现;二是跨系统数据的一致性要求,不同业务系统间的信息需要保持同步;三是运维成本的持续压缩,企业对于智能化运维的需求愈发迫切。这些压力共同推动着自动更新技术的演进。

二、制约自动更新的核心问题有哪些

经过对行业实践的深入调研,影响AI知识库自动更新的核心问题可以归纳为以下几个方面:

2.1 数据源质量参差不齐

自动更新的首要前提是拥有可靠的数据源。但在实际场景中,数据源的質量往往参差不齐。部分数据更新频率过低,无法满足时效性要求;部分数据格式不规范,自动化处理难度大;更有部分数据存在冲突或错误,需要人工介入核实。小浣熊AI智能助手在处理数据源时,采用了多源交叉验证的策略,通过比对多个数据源的一致性来过滤异常信息,这一做法在实践中取得了较好效果。

2.2 更新阈值难以精准把控

另一个关键问题在于如何判断知识是否需要更新。更新过于频繁,会增加系统负载,影响稳定性;更新过于保守,又会导致信息滞后。行业目前普遍采用的方式是结合时间阈值与变更检测,但这种方法在面对不同类型知识时,效果差异明显。例如,对于政策文件类知识,时间阈值较为有效;但对于业务数据类知识,变更检测更为关键。

2.3 版本兼容性管理复杂

随着知识的持续更新,版本兼容性管理成为棘手问题。新旧知识之间可能存在逻辑冲突,版本回滚需求也时有发生。特别是在复杂业务场景中,一个知识点的变更可能影响多个相关联的知识条目,如果缺乏有效的版本管理机制,很容易引发连锁错误。

2.4 自动化流程的异常处理

自动更新流程并非总是一帆风顺。网络波动、接口异常、数据格式突变等情况时有发生。当异常发生时,如何快速感知、定位并恢复,是保障系统稳定性的关键。当前很多解决方案在这方面存在明显短板,故障恢复时间过长,影响了整体可用性。

三、问题背后的深层根源分析

上述问题的产生,并非偶然,而是由多重因素共同作用的结果。

从技术层面看,AI知识库的自动更新涉及数据采集、清洗、转换、存储、服务等多个技术环节,每个环节都有其独特的技术挑战。例如,数据清洗环节需要处理各种非结构化文本,这至今仍是自然语言处理领域的难点。数据转换环节则需要处理不同系统间的数据模型差异,这往往需要大量的定制开发。

从管理层面看,知识库的维护责任边界往往不够清晰。技术团队负责系统运行,业务团队负责内容准确性,但在实际协作中,两个团队之间的衔接常常存在缝隙。这种管理上的模糊,导致很多更新需求无法及时传递到技术层面,或者传递后得不到有效执行。

从成本层面看,自动更新系统的建设需要持续投入,但这种投入的回报往往难以量化。很多企业在初期评估时,容易低估维护成本,导致后续投入不足。这也是为什么很多知识库系统在上线后,更新机制逐渐弱化的重要原因。

从生态层面看,AI知识库并非孤立存在,而是与企业的业务系统、运维系统、安全系统等多个系统相互关联。任何一个环节的变化,都可能对知识库产生影响。这种复杂的依赖关系,增加了自动更新的难度。

四、务实可行的解决路径

针对上述问题,结合行业最佳实践,可以从以下几个维度构建解决方案:

4.1 建立分级分类的数据更新机制

不同类型的知识,其更新策略应当有所差异。小浣熊AI智能助手采用了知识分类管理的方法,将知识划分为静态知识、动态知识和高频知识三类。静态知识如基础概念定义,更新频率极低,可采用人工审核制;动态知识如业务流程描述,采用事件触发式更新;高频知识如实时数据,采用定时批量更新。这种分级策略有效平衡了更新及时性与系统开销。

具体实施时,建议建立知识评分体系,根据知识的使用频率、变更概率、影响范围等维度,给每条知识打分,据此确定其更新策略。同时,要建立知识的热力图谱,标识出哪些知识是核心知识、哪些是边缘知识,核心知识的更新需要更加审慎。

4.2 构建智能化的数据质量管控体系

数据质量是自动更新的生命线。需要建立多层次的质量管控机制:在数据入口层,设置格式校验规则,不符合规范的数据直接拒绝;在数据处理层,采用机器学习算法识别异常数据;在数据出口层,通过抽样审核确保输出质量。

值得关注的是,小浣熊AI智能助手的质量管控模块引入了对抗性检测机制,即通过模拟各种异常情况,验证更新流程的健壮性。这种做法值得借鉴,因为它不仅能发现问题,更能提前暴露系统的脆弱点。

4.3 实施精细化的版本管理系统

版本管理不仅要有,更要精细。建议采用双向版本策略:一方面保留完整的历史版本,支持任意时间点的回滚;另一方面建立增量版本机制,只记录变更部分,降低存储开销。

版本冲突的检测与处理是另一个重点。建议引入三向合并算法,当新旧版本发生冲突时,系统自动尝试合并,合并失败的提交人工审核。同时,建立版本血缘关系图谱,清晰展示各版本之间的关联,便于问题追溯。

4.4 设计健壮的异常处理机制

自动更新系统必须具备完善的异常处理能力。建议采用分级告警机制:根据异常的严重程度,触发不同级别的响应。轻微异常自动记录并继续执行,中度异常暂停流程并通知运维人员,严重异常立即回滚并告警。

同时,要建立故障演练制度,定期模拟各种异常场景,检验系统的响应能力。小浣熊AI智能助手在这方面的实践是每季度进行一次全链路故障演练,确保团队具备快速响应能力。

4.5 打通业务协同的最后一公里

技术方案再完善,如果缺乏业务支撑也难以落地。建议建立常态化的业务沟通机制,技术团队与业务团队定期同步知识库的状态与需求。可以设立知识管理员角色,专门负责业务侧与技术侧的衔接。

另外,引入知识众包机制也值得考虑。在部分场景下,可以调动一线业务人员的积极性,让他们参与到知识验证与反馈中来。这种方式既能减轻专职团队的压力,又能提高知识的准确性。

五、实施过程中的注意事项

在推进AI知识库自动更新的过程中,有几点需要特别注意。

首先,循序渐进而非急于求成。建议先从单一知识领域入手,验证方案可行性后再逐步推广。一次性的全面替换风险过大,一旦出现问题影响面太广。

其次,监控先行。在实施任何更新策略之前,必须先建立完善的监控系统,实时掌握知识库的各项指标。监控内容包括更新成功率、响应延迟、错误分布等,这些数据是持续优化的基础。

再次,保持一定的冗余度。自动更新系统本身也需要维护,要预留足够的资源应对突发情况。不要将所有资源都用于日常更新,否则当系统需要额外处理能力时会捉襟见肘。

最后,注重团队能力建设。再好的系统也需要人来操作,要为运维团队提供充足的培训,使其能够熟练应对各种场景。同时,建立知识库,将常见问题的处理方法文档化,降低对个人经验的依赖。


综上所述,AI知识库的自动更新与维护是一个系统性工程,需要技术、管理、成本等多个维度的协同推进。通过建立分级分类的更新机制、智能化的质量管控体系、精细化的版本管理、健壮的异常处理以及顺畅的业务协同,可以有效解决当前面临的痛点。值得注意的是,自动更新并非一劳永逸,而是需要持续优化迭代的过程。只有在实践中不断总结经验,才能构建起真正高效、稳定的AI知识库运营体系。

小浣熊家族 Raccoon - AI 智能助手 - 商汤科技

办公小浣熊是商汤科技推出的AI办公助手,办公小浣熊2.0版本全新升级

代码小浣熊办公小浣熊